JSBA To Present ‘Chuggington LIVE!’ At Reg Lenna April 7

An interactive locomotive experience is in store for area children and their families when “Chuggington LIVE! The Great Rescue Adventure” comes to Jamestown next month.

The live-action musical children’s show, based on the popular television series, rolls into the Reg Lenna Center for the Arts on Tuesday, April 7, at 6:30 p.m. for its Jamestown premiere – giving young fans and their families the opportunity to experience the “train-tastic” adventures of the Chuggington trainees, Wilson, Brewster and Koko.

The brand new production is being presented by the Jamestown Savings Bank Arena, and is part of a national tour that will encompass the eastern half of the country. It showcases trains with working features and movements that bring the Chuggington TV series characters to life on stage in a two-act musical, which will be presented before a giant LED video wall featuring animated locations and background action sequences from the popular TV series.

According to Nick Trussalo, creative director for the JSBA, it was decided by the arena to bring Chuggington to Jamestown in order to expand its entertainment offerings and appeal to a wider audience.

“We were looking for events to book and stumbled across this national tour that Chuggington is doing,” Trussalo said. “We thought it was the perfect show to expand our venue options, and so we rented the Reg Lenna Center for the Arts because it had a stage that would better accommodate the show. The JSBA is still presenting the event.

“It’s a family friendly show that has a ton of appeal for kids,” he added. “There’s a huge difference between seeing the characters on TV and them seeing them live, up-close and in person.”

The premise of the production centers around anthropomorphic train engines, referred to as “trainees,” and their human engineer counterparts. The trainees are eager to impress their mentors by mastering new roles that test their courage, speed and determination. When trainee Koko finds herself in trouble at Rocky Ridge Mine, her friends opt to help her by putting their newly learned skills into practice.

The live production features life-size Chuggington train carriages live on stage, complete with working mouths and eyes. The backdrop for the live show is a video wall featuring animated interactive backgrounds to the live stage action. It is produced by Life Like Touring and Ludorum.

First launched on Disney Junior in 2010, the Chuggington TV series now airs in more than 178 countries and is translated into 36 different languages. In the United States, the TV show can be seen 22 times per week between the Disney Junior and Disney TV channels, with an estimated 2 million viewers every week.
